6. Stage test accuracy

Making certain the proper transmission fluid stage following a Toyota Tundra transmission fluid change is paramount for the system’s optimum performance and longevity. A exact stage test ensures ample lubrication and hydraulic strain inside the transmission, stopping potential harm and efficiency degradation.

  • Temperature Dependence

    Transmission fluid quantity is considerably affected by temperature. An correct stage test necessitates bringing the fluid to a specified temperature vary, as outlined by Toyota. Fluid expands because it heats, so a stage that seems right when chilly could also be inadequate at working temperature. Using diagnostic instruments to watch transmission fluid temperature in the course of the test is essential. For instance, the Tundra’s service guide might specify a fluid stage vary inside a temperature window of 90-110 levels Fahrenheit. Checking the extent outdoors this vary will yield inaccurate outcomes.

  • Process Adherence

    Toyota gives an in depth process for checking the transmission fluid stage, which should be adopted exactly. This sometimes entails operating the engine, shifting via gears, and permitting the fluid to achieve the required temperature earlier than eradicating the test plug. Deviation from this process, corresponding to skipping the gear choice step or checking the extent with the engine off, will compromise the accuracy of the measurement. For example, the Tundra’s process might require shifting via Park, Reverse, Impartial, Drive, after which again to Park earlier than opening the test plug.

  • Appropriate Measurement Approach

    The strategy of figuring out the fluid stage usually entails a test plug on the transmission pan. When the fluid is on the right stage, a small quantity ought to trickle out when the plug is eliminated. If no fluid emerges, or if a major quantity pours out, the extent is wrong. Distinguishing between a trickle and a gentle stream is vital for correct evaluation. Visible inspection of the fluid stream, mixed with an understanding of the anticipated stream charge, aids in exact willpower of the fluid stage. Utilizing a clear container to catch the fluid permits for higher commentary.

  • Penalties of Incorrect Ranges

    Each overfilling and underfilling the transmission can result in issues. Underfilling leads to insufficient lubrication, growing friction and warmth, and doubtlessly inflicting harm to gears and clutch packs. Overfilling may cause fluid aeration, decreasing its capability to lubricate and funky, and doubtlessly resulting in foaming and fluid expulsion via the vent. These penalties underscore the significance of exact stage checking and adjustment. Constant underfilling, for instance, can lead to transmission slippage, significantly throughout gear modifications, resulting in untimely put on and eventual failure.

Often Requested Questions

This part addresses widespread inquiries concerning the upkeep process, providing readability on key features and dispelling potential misconceptions.

Query 1: What constitutes the optimum interval for performing a transmission fluid change on a Toyota Tundra?

The really useful interval varies primarily based on driving circumstances. For regular utilization, the interval is often specified within the proprietor’s guide. Extreme working circumstances, corresponding to frequent towing or off-road driving, necessitate extra frequent fluid modifications.

Query 2: Is it crucial to interchange the transmission filter throughout a fluid change?

Filter alternative is strongly suggested. The filter captures contaminants, and neglecting its alternative can compromise the effectiveness of the brand new fluid, resulting in untimely put on.

Query 3: What sort of transmission fluid is acceptable for a Toyota Tundra?

Adherence to the fluid specification outlined within the proprietor’s guide is vital. Utilizing an incorrect fluid may cause important harm. Toyota WS fluid is often specified, however verification primarily based on the mannequin yr is crucial.

Query 4: Can transmission fluid be overfilled? What are the results?

Overfilling is detrimental. It could trigger fluid aeration, decreasing lubrication effectivity and doubtlessly resulting in fluid expulsion and harm to transmission parts.

Query 5: Is a transmission flush preferable to a regular fluid drain and fill?

A typical drain and fill is usually really useful for routine upkeep. A flush, whereas doubtlessly eradicating extra contaminants, can dislodge particles that would then impede valve our bodies. Seek the advice of a certified technician for steering.

Query 6: What are the indications {that a} transmission fluid change is overdue?

Warning indicators embody erratic shifting, slippage throughout gear modifications, and a noticeable decline in gasoline financial system. A visible inspection of the fluid, noting its coloration and odor, may present a sign of its situation.
